Calculation method

How the calculation works

Scale the recipe batch from planned servings and edible portion size, correct for usable yield, add a waste buffer, round packages upward, and reconcile purchase quantity, surplus, ingredient cost, labor, and cost per serving. Multiply servings by edible quantity, divide by yield for raw need, add the contingency allowance, round to whole packages, and add labor to ingredient cost.

Worked situations

Practical examples

  • Eighty 0.35-unit portions require 28 edible units before yield loss.
  • An 82% yield raises the raw requirement above the finished quantity.
  • Package rounding can create usable surplus for another menu item.

Better inputs

Useful tips

  • Keep spices, leaveners, and thickeners on recipe-specific scaling rules.
  • Test very large batches because mixing and heat transfer may not scale linearly.
  • Record purchased, prepared, and served weights after production.

Before relying on the result

Limitations and common mistakes

  • One blended edible portion, yield, and package is modeled.
  • Ingredient-specific ratios, pan capacity, oven load, and food-safety controls require a production recipe.
  • The result is a purchasing plan, not a validated formulation.

Reference

Key terms

Edible quantity
Finished amount intended to be served.
Usable yield
Finished usable amount divided by raw quantity.
Package surplus
Purchased quantity remaining after the modeled raw requirement.

Frequently asked questions

Can every ingredient use the same yield?

No. Use this for the principal quantity and maintain ingredient-specific yields in the recipe.

Why is purchased quantity higher than required?

Whole-package rounding creates surplus.

Does doubling a recipe always work?

Not for every ingredient or process; verify seasoning, leavening, vessel size, and cook time.
